[opendmarc-users] debugging dmarc=fail

Chris Meidinger cmeidinger at sendmail.com
Thu Mar 21 15:49:24 PDT 2013


I have been working on setting up opendmarc on a test machine today, and am running into an issue that I'm not finding a good way to debug. I'm hoping someone can help me.

I am using sendmail with opendkim and an SPF checker before opendmarc, both of those pass, but dmarc fails:

Authentication-Results: dmz205.smi-training.net/r2LMVHUn013122; dmarc=fail header.from=dmz205.smi-training.net
Authentication-Results: dmz205.smi-training.net; dkim=pass (1024-bit key) header.i=@dmz205.smi-training.net header.b=fUcrnROO; dkim-adsp=pass
Authentication-Results: dmz205.smi-training.net; spf=PASS (sender IP is 192.168.200.205) smtp.mailfrom=chris at dmz205.smi-training.net

I am not getting anything clearer in test mode either:

[root at dmz205 ~]# opendmarc -c /etc/mail/opendmarc.conf -t source.mime -vv
opendmarc: mlfi_connect() returned SMFIS_CONTINUE
opendmarc: source.mime: mlfi_envfrom() returned SMFIS_CONTINUE
opendmarc: source.mime: line 1: mlfi_header() returned SMFIS_CONTINUE
opendmarc: source.mime: line 2: mlfi_header() returned SMFIS_CONTINUE
opendmarc: source.mime: line 6: mlfi_header() returned SMFIS_CONTINUE
opendmarc: source.mime: line 7: mlfi_header() returned SMFIS_CONTINUE
opendmarc: source.mime: line 8: mlfi_header() returned SMFIS_CONTINUE
opendmarc: source.mime: line 10: mlfi_header() returned SMFIS_CONTINUE
opendmarc: source.mime: line 11: mlfi_header() returned SMFIS_CONTINUE
opendmarc: source.mime: line 18: mlfi_header() returned SMFIS_CONTINUE
opendmarc: source.mime: line 19: mlfi_header() returned SMFIS_CONTINUE
opendmarc: source.mime: line 20: mlfi_header() returned SMFIS_CONTINUE
opendmarc: source.mime: line 21: mlfi_header() returned SMFIS_CONTINUE
opendmarc: source.mime: line 22: mlfi_header() returned SMFIS_CONTINUE
opendmarc: source.mime: line 23: mlfi_header() returned SMFIS_CONTINUE
opendmarc: source.mime: line 24: mlfi_header() returned SMFIS_CONTINUE
opendmarc: source.mime: line 25: mlfi_header() returned SMFIS_CONTINUE
opendmarc: source.mime: line 26: mlfi_header() returned SMFIS_CONTINUE
### INSHEADER: idx=1 hname='Authentication-Results' hvalue='dmz205.smi-training.net/DEBUG-i; dmarc=fail header.from=dmz205.smi-training.net'

As far as I can tell DNS is working and the headers are correct, how can I see exactly what is causing dmarc=fail?

Thanks!!

Chris 


More information about the opendmarc-users mailing list